·pytest-coder
</>

pytest-coder

Scrivi test pytest con dispositivi, parametrizzazione, mocking, test asincroni e modelli moderni. Da utilizzare durante la creazione o l'aggiornamento dei file di test Python. Non per unittest: utilizza invece modelli di libreria standard.

23Installazioni·1Tendenza·@majesticlabs-dev

Installazione

$npx skills add https://github.com/majesticlabs-dev/majestic-marketplace --skill pytest-coder

Come installare pytest-coder

Installa rapidamente la skill AI pytest-coder nel tuo ambiente di sviluppo tramite riga di comando

  1. Apri il terminale: Apri il tuo terminale o strumento da riga di comando (Terminal, iTerm, Windows Terminal, ecc.)
  2. Esegui il comando di installazione: Copia ed esegui questo comando: npx skills add https://github.com/majesticlabs-dev/majestic-marketplace --skill pytest-coder
  3. Verifica l'installazione: Dopo l'installazione, la skill verrà configurata automaticamente nel tuo ambiente AI di coding e sarà pronta all'uso in Claude Code, Cursor o OpenClaw

Fonte: majesticlabs-dev/majestic-marketplace.

| AAA Pattern | Arrange-Act-Assert for every test | | Behavior over Implementation | Test what code does, not how | | Isolation | Tests must be independent | | Fast Tests | Mock I/O, minimize database hits | | Descriptive Names | Test name explains the scenario | | Coverage | Test happy paths AND edge cases |

| function | Per test (default) | Most fixtures | | class | Per test class | Shared setup within class | | module | Per module | Expensive setup shared by module | | session | Entire test run | Database connections, servers |

| Tests depend on order | Flaky, hard to debug | Use fixtures, isolate | | Testing implementation | Brittle tests | Test behavior | | Too many assertions | Hard to identify failure | One assertion per test | | No error case tests | Missing coverage | Test exceptions explicitly | | Slow unit tests | Slow feedback | Mock I/O, use in-memory DB |

Fatti (pronti per citazione)

Campi e comandi stabili per citazioni AI/ricerca.

Comando di installazione
npx skills add https://github.com/majesticlabs-dev/majestic-marketplace --skill pytest-coder
Categoria
</>Sviluppo
Verificato
Prima apparizione
2026-02-23
Aggiornato
2026-03-10

Browse more skills from majesticlabs-dev/majestic-marketplace

Risposte rapide

Che cos'è pytest-coder?

Scrivi test pytest con dispositivi, parametrizzazione, mocking, test asincroni e modelli moderni. Da utilizzare durante la creazione o l'aggiornamento dei file di test Python. Non per unittest: utilizza invece modelli di libreria standard. Fonte: majesticlabs-dev/majestic-marketplace.

Come installo pytest-coder?

Apri il tuo terminale o strumento da riga di comando (Terminal, iTerm, Windows Terminal, ecc.) Copia ed esegui questo comando: npx skills add https://github.com/majesticlabs-dev/majestic-marketplace --skill pytest-coder Dopo l'installazione, la skill verrà configurata automaticamente nel tuo ambiente AI di coding e sarà pronta all'uso in Claude Code, Cursor o OpenClaw

Dov'è il repository sorgente?

https://github.com/majesticlabs-dev/majestic-marketplace